Today, I rise in support of this bill to honor a group of brave men who have yet to receive their due commendation: the Harlem Hellfighters. This distinguished group of African-American and Puerto Rican men were patriots of the highest valor. Their bravery, dedication, perseverance, and service helped the United States and our Allied forces in our fight to secure victory. But, Madam Speaker, these fighters weren't even permitted to serve alongside their fellow White soldiers. Our government threw them to the side--assigning them to a unit of the French Government rather than our own. They put their lives on the line for the freedoms enshrined in our Constitution, despite doing so at a time when many like them did not enjoy the very freedoms they fought to protect.
